If you are concerned about maximizing veg time you should start them indoors.

A small investment in some CFl bulbs and you can germ and veg for a while inside before putting them out in April.

If you do this don't forget to harden the plants by gradually giving them more and more real sun so they can adjust to all that light. Sticking them straight out in full sun can damage or even kill a young plant that is used to indoor lighting.

Starting early is truly the key to success. Plants that are established with a few leaves and a good root system are much more successful when put outside than those which are grown outside when weather permits. Ideally you would want to place a six or 8 week old baby outside in early May after danger of frost has passed and some other local plants are growing so that bugs don't feast on your babies.
